Environment Variables — ProseCheck Documentation Linter

This page lists env vars the support team may need when customers report linter failures. PROSECHECK_RULESET selects the rule bundle, PROSECHECK_LOG_LEVEL controls verbosity, and PROSECHECK_CACHE_DIR sets the cache path. Most escalations come down to a missing auth entry: without it, the linter exits with code 41 before scanning any files. When rebuilding a customer's env file, confirm it contains the following line:

sealed setting: VAULT_KEY20=69e2a0b23f1a79fbf692

## Service Accounts — StormFan Alert Fan-Out

The fan-out worker authenticates to the internal dispatch tier using the svc-stormfan account. Rotate quarterly; scopes are limited to publish-only on alert topics. If deliveries stall during your shift, verify the worker is using the current credential, reproduced below for reference.

API key for kaweg-hahif: kto4_rAjZ

Managers-Only Wiki — Possible Acquisition of Dunmoor Optics

Quick heads-up for the board: we've been kicking the tyres on Dunmoor Optics, the lens maker out of Hartsvale. Their order book is solid, margins around 22%, and their founder is reportedly open to a sale. Fit with our Clearfield instrument line looks strong, though their debt load needs a closer look. Nothing signed, nothing promised — keep this strictly inside the managers' circle. The confidential note on next steps sits just below.

board note of kageg-bahof: The renewal with Holwynax Holdings closes at $2 million a year, 5 percent below the last contract. Project Ulaath slips by two quarters because of the supplier delay.

## Support

DeployBeak is our little chat bot that answers deploy-status questions in team channels — ask it things like "status of checkout" and it'll fetch the latest pipeline state. Plugin authors can extend it via the hooks API documented in `docs/hooks.md`. Heads up: webhook payloads changed in v2, so older plugins need the shim. If your plugin misbehaves or you want a review, drop us a line at the address below.

escalation mailbox, hahof-fahag: istwyn.prawyn@qirvanlabs.internal